  • In a server proxy how can I use a INCLUDE STRUCTURE?

    Hi people!!, how can I put an internal table with an INCLUDE statement in a server proxy in abap. If I put the next code the system present me this error: Within classes and interfaces, you can only use "TYPE" to refer to ABAP     , Dictionary types, not "LIKE" or "STRUCTURE".
    The problem is that I need the STRUCTURE to make a APPEND.
    Thanks for the help.
    DATA: BEGIN OF bdc_tab .
            INCLUDE STRUCTURE bdcdata.
    DATA: END OF bdc_tab.

    Hi Carlos,
    Yes. It mainly accepts TYPE statements.
    You can use this as:
    DATA: BDC_LINE type bdcdata.
    DATA: BDC_TAB type table of bdcdata.
    When you want to use,
    Fill the BDC_LINE.
    Then:
    Append BDC_LINE to BDC_TAB.
    Or:
    Loop at BDC_TAB into BDC_LINE.
    Cheers,
    Bhanu

  • How do I Make Include Structures Expand Automatically?

    As usual some of the simplest things take the longest time.
    I've created a custom structure in the dictionary.  I've also created a custom table in which I include the structure. I expected that after I added the include structure to the custom table, that it would be expanded and display in se11, and behave just as SAP-delivered tables do.  For example, look at table PA0001. There are include lines followed by the contents of the include.
    In my custom table though, I only see the include line itself.  To see the structure I must expand it by pressing the expand button.  Each and every time I display the custom table I must manually expand it.  I want the behavior I see on every other SAP table.
    Any ideas?
    Thank you.
    Tom

    Hi,
    if You have include structure in Your table, all fields are displayed only in display mode.
    That is the way You see the PA0001 table.
    If You create your own table and include structure, in edit mode You can change fields of the include structure,
    that is why it is not expanded. But if You change from edit to display mode, SAP does not expand it automatically.
    You should display in SE11 this table - all fields will be visible.

  • Extended syntax check for include structure

    Hello Everyone,
    While declaring the internal table as:
    TYPES: BEGIN OF t_data.
            INCLUDE STRUCTURE mara.
    TYPES: END   OF t_data.
    DATA: it_data TYPE table of t_data.
    When performing extended check, i get following error:
    The current ABAP command is obsolete and problematic, especially so in ABAP
    Objects
    Within classes and interfaces, you can only use "TYPE" to refer to ABAP Dictionary
    types, not "LIKE" or "STRUCTURE".
    I am using 4.7 version.
    Any clue how to avoid this error during extended check.
    Regards,
    Tarun

    Tarun,
    With WAS 6.20 you should not declare internal tables with header line or using the old syntax as they are not compatible with OO ABAP.
    So, you either declare a TYPE the way you have done, in case you want additional fields apart from the INCLUDE structure, or declare the table directly like the way I have shown.
    Good thing, you can even specify the type of internal table that you want to create using this - STANDARD, SORTED, HASH. These tables will help you with the performance issues.

  • Problem with primary/secondary keys in table with included structures

    Dear ABAPers,
    we have a structure which is supposed to be included in the definition of several tables.
    The problem is the following:
    depending on the application table that includes this structure, 3 or 4 fields of that structure may
    or may not be necessary to enhance the table key. As far as I know included structures can only
    completely be marked as keys. Therefore I suggested to split up the structure into two parts,
    one part with the possible candidates that may become key fields, and the rest, and of course
    a structure that unites both of these substructures. So when it comes to reusing this structure
    the developer would have the choice to select the structure with all of the fields in case no field
    is needed as additional key, or the developer would have to implement both of the substructures
    separately with the option to mark the key-part of it as key in his table.
    But unfortunetaly this suggestion of mine was refused as being too complicated and I am supposed
    to define all the fields in one flat structure and to "enhance" the primary keys (that always will exist)
    by secondary keys.
    Does anybody know how that is supposed to work without defining double indexes?
    I cannot activate a table without having primary keys defined and any unique secondary index would
    allways include all of the primary keys.
    Thanks in advance for you help
    (I'm sorry that you cannot be granted reward points for just reading the extensive problem description)
    regards
    Andreas

    Dear Rob,
    since your answer was helpful and since it was the only one I will grant you full points on that.
    Thanks again for your input. In case other developers should look this thread up being confronted
    with the same kind of problem, here is how we solved it:
    We added an artificial primary key (a number of type NUMC 8) to the table which is supposed to
    include the structure. This key alone takes care of the uniqueness of eacht entry.
    All the others fields that we want to have available for a fast direct access, including the ones
    from the included structure, are put together in a secondary index.
